Get dressed at the hotel or venue?

juicyj19, on March 15, 2019 at 11:48 PM Posted in Wedding Attire 2 7

I am getting a hotel suite with my bridesmaids the night before the wedding. The plan is to get hair and makeup done and take some pictures in our robes in the room. However, I am not sure if I should put my wedding dress on at the hotel or wait until I go over to the venue to get dressed. The venue is 10 minutes away from the hotel. What suggestions do you guys have?

    How are you getting from hotel to venue? If you’re getting married in the summer it can be hot getting into a parked car (unless someone like Uber, a friend or a black car is coming to get you), let alone getting into the car in a wedding dress. What is the shape of your dress, will it fit comfortably - without getting too wrinkled - in whatever kind of car you’ll be in? Is there a dedicated (and pretty if that photo is important to you) space at your venue for you to get into your dress?

    I agree with pps, I think this depends on your transportation and the facilities at your venue. Daughter and the BMs spent the morning of the wedding at our home after getting hair & make-up done separately. We had lunch and the photographer arrived to take some getting ready shots of the girls. Then the BMs all put their dresses on and we drove in three cars to the venue. Daughter was completely ready except for putting her dress on. There was a very specific shot she wanted of her dress hanging from above a big double staircase at the venue, so the photographer did that first thing. Then all the women went down to the "bride's room" which was clean & bright, but not very big, and daughter put her dress on there with the photographer's assistant taking pictures of the girls and me helping her. Right after that, she did a first look with FOB (who we'd kept her dress hidden from for a year Smiley winking ), and then first look with the groom. After that they did a bunch of wedding pictures. The ceremony began about 2.5 hours after the time we arrived at the venue.

    1) Is there a suitable place to change into your dress at the venue and 2) how are you getting from the hotel to your venue. I wouldn't want to put my dress on in a bathroom or anything, but I also wouldn't want to smush it into anything less but a perfectly clean car. Also depending on the style of your dress one option may be a lot more practical.
